Transaction ec32e6c091971f0aa55ce5e557e343d4e7398962e61cd12fab5ef7e8d4a4dc71
1 Input
1 Output
-
ec32e6c091971f0aa55ce5e557e343d4e7398962e61cd12fab5ef7e8d4a4dc71:0
- value
- 16228
- script pubkey
- OP_0 OP_PUSHBYTES_20 880ec3fc6cb7108f53a53f5c08b8b236994abcdf
- address
- bc1q3q8v8lrvkugg75a98awq3w9jx6v540xlnnfhg6